Output 83c56355893db541267398472fecd42d111463ffb19d110400e7eaf4808a86d8:0

value
1700816
script pubkey
OP_0 OP_PUSHBYTES_20 3668e5950ad45a0921e526107c01b45b5912f1f6
address
bc1qxe5wt9g263dqjg09ycg8cqd5tdv39u0k3t69ux
transaction
83c56355893db541267398472fecd42d111463ffb19d110400e7eaf4808a86d8
confirmations
190757
spent
true